Telangana Pradesh Congress Committee (TPCC) president and MLC B. Mahesh Kumar Goud said farmers’ welfare remained at the centre of the government’s policies in the 1000 days of the Congress government’s rule , with the crop loans up to ₹2 lakh waived, providing relief to 25.35 lakh farmers by expending more than ₹20,000 crore.
